The City of Mapleton had a population of 1,454 as of July 1, 2023.
The primary coordinate point for Mapleton is located at latitude 46.8891 and longitude -97.0526 in Cass County. The formal boundaries for the City of Mapleton encompass a land area of 4 sq. miles and a water area of 0 sq. miles. Cass County is in the Central time zone (GMT -6).
The City of Mapleton has a C5 Census Class Code which indicates an active incorporated place that is independent of any county subdivision and serves as a county subdivision equivalent. It also has a Functional Status Code of "A" which identifies an active government providing primary general-purpose functions.
